ISBN: 0849960991 ISBN-13: 9780849960994 Publisher: W Publishing Group OUR PRICE: $14.39 Product Type: Analog Audio Cassette - Other Formats Published: March 1994 Annotation: 'Nowadays the word sin is rarely used in public discourse, ' says John MacArthur. 'Human misbehavior is usually treated as a medical problem rather than a moral one. Guilt is seen as a harmful emotion and, as a result, guilt feelings are denied rather than dealt with.'And, unfortunately, the church has become part of the problem instead of the solution. Instead of proclaiming the Bible's teaching about depravity and guilt and repentance, the church too often echoes the world's thinking on the psychology of guilt and the importance of feeling good about ourselves.Audiobook |
